NST bid to enhance its network

DIMAPUR, NOVEMBER 18

NAGALAND State Transport (NST) is gearing to enhance its network soon following commissioning of an additional twenty new buses. The buses were commissioned this afternoon in the office premises of the Additional Chief Engineer (Automobile), at the NST Central Workshop, Tata Parking, Dimapur. This should boost the deprived State public transport services and prove to be a boon to people particularly in rural areas of the State. With this input they can look forward to a little more comfort this winter while travelling on roads in need of dire repair.
The newly commissioned public buses comprise of eight (8) Super Deluxe, ten (10) Semi Deluxe and two (2) Mini Buses. The buses were procured with the stipulated budget amounting to Rs 4.5 crores which was made available with the department during the fiscal year 2012-13.
Interacting with media persons, Additional General Manager, Senti Pongener, said the body of the buses were constructed from a renowned firm namely Amar Coach Builders in Jalandhar city, Punjab. He expressed satisfaction that the firm kept their word and delivered the vehicles during peak travel season. Besides, he also said two mini buses were built by RD Body Builders and Automobiles, Khatkhati, Assam.
While acknowledging immense pressures from various districts for new buses, Senti Pongener, expressed skepticism to meet all the demands.
The transport department is keen to operate these new buses solely on lucrative routes for the department. As such two Super Deluxe buses have been earmarked to operate between Kohima and Shillong.
The new buses were commissioned by senior pastor Rev. Shiwoto Sema, who also said the dedicatory prayer. In his exhortation, Rev. Shiwoto has urged the NST Department to be different from other departments by fully committing to public service, saying “customers’ satisfaction should be your satisfaction.’
Other dignitaries who were present on the occasion included Additional Chief Engineer R. Nrio Lotha; Joint General Manager Howoto Sema; Senior Automobile Engineer Er. Atovi Kiba; Joint Manager OE Yanthan; and other departmental staff.
